A Comprehensive Guide to Woven Trellis for Gardening175
Woven trellis is a versatile and decorative way to support climbing plants in your garden. It can be used to create arbors, trellises, and other structures that provide support for vines, roses, and other climbing plants. Woven trellis is also a great way to add a touch of rustic charm to your outdoor space.
Materials
To make woven trellis, you will need the following materials:* Willow or other pliable wood
* Scissors or pruning shears
* Hammer or mallet
* Nails or staples
Instructions
To make woven trellis, follow these steps:1. Cut the willow or other pliable wood into strips that are about 1 inch wide and 6 feet long.
2. Lay two of the strips parallel to each other, about 6 inches apart.
3. Take a third strip and weave it over and under the first two strips, starting at one end.
4. Continue weaving the third strip until you reach the other end of the first two strips.
5. Take a fourth strip and weave it over and under the first three strips, starting at the opposite end of the first two strips.
6. Continue weaving the fourth strip until you reach the end of the first three strips.
7. Repeat steps 3-6 until you have created a trellis of the desired size.
8. Secure the ends of the trellis with nails or staples.
Tips
Here are a few tips for making woven trellis:* Use fresh willow or other pliable wood for best results.
* Soak the wood in water for a few hours before weaving to make it more flexible.
* Weave the strips tightly together to create a strong and durable trellis.
* Be patient and take your time. Weaving trellis can be a relaxing and rewarding activity.
Variations
There are many different variations on the basic woven trellis design. You can experiment with different weaving patterns, shapes, and sizes to create a trellis that is unique to your garden. Here are a few ideas:* Use different colors of wood to create a more decorative trellis.
* Weave the trellis into a circle or other shape.
* Add embellishments to the trellis, such as beads, shells, or other decorative items.
